>> I'm building ffmpeg(current git head) but get the following error, and then can't step up next...
>>
>> libavcodec/libsvtav1.c:438:70: error: too many arguments to function call, expected 2, have 3
>> 438 | svt_ret = svt_av1_enc_init_handle(&svt_enc->svt_handle, svt_enc, &svt_enc->enc_params);
> The API of svtav1 changed recently:
> https://gitlab.com/AOMediaCodec/SVT-AV1/-/commit/988e930c1083ce518ead1d364e3a486e9209bf73
>
> Until ffmpeg fixes the problem, you need to either use a slightly older
> version of svtav1, or patch ffmpeg with the patch included in that
> commit:
The hold-up is due to SVT-AV1:
